HDMI Input & Output Connectors
HDMI Inputs 6 HDMI Type A (19-pin) connectors
HDMI Output 1 HDMI Type A (19-pin) connector
HDMI Performance
Video Resolutions 480i, 480p, 576i, 576p, 720p, 1080i (resolutions dependent
on the capability of the HDMI display connected to the
MC12HD HDMI output connector)
Audio Sample Rates 44.1kHz, 48kHz, 88.2kHz, 96kHz
Audio Inputs and Outputs
Analog Audio Inputs Eight stereo pairs (RCA) or five stereo pairs and one
5.1-channel analog input
Digital Audio Inputs Six S/PDIF coaxial (RCA), six S/PDIF optical (including one
optical mini jack), one AES/EBU (XLR); coaxial and optical
inputs conform to IEC-958, S/PDIF standards
Sample Rates: 44.1, 48, 88.2, 96kHz
Accepts: 16-24 bits PCM audio, Dolby Digital, Dolby Digital EX, DTS
& DTS-ES discrete data formats
Main Audio Outputs Twelve unbalanced (RCA) and twelve balanced (XLR, MC-12HD
Balanced only) connectors for Front L/R, Center, LFE, Subwoofer
L/R, Side L/R, Rear L/R, Auxiliary L/R
Zone 2 Audio Outputs 2 unbalanced (RCA, 1 fixed and 1 variable output level) stereo
connectors and 1 balanced stereo connector (XLR, variable
output level, MC-12HD Balanced only)
Record Audio Outputs 2 unbalanced (RCA, 1 fixed and 1 variable output level) stereo
connectors • 1 S/PDIF coaxial (RCA) and 1 S/PDIF optical
connector (in parallel)
Performance (Main Zone)
Analog-to-Digital 24-bit, 96kHz, dual-bit S! architecture
Conversion
Digital-to-Analog 24-bit, 44.1 to 192kHz, multi-bit S! architecture,
Conversion operating in dual-mono mode
Frequency Response 10Hz to 20kHz, +0.1dB/-0.25dB, -0.75dB at 40kHz,
reference 1kHz
THD + Noise Below 0.003% at 1kHz, maximum output level
Dynamic Range 108dB minimum, 111dB typical, 22kHz bandwidth
Signal-to-Noise Ratio 108dB minimum, 111dB typical, 22kHz bandwidth
Input Sensitivity
200mVrms (2Vrms for maximum output level) at 0dB input gain
Input Impedance 100k" in parallel with 150pF
Output Level
150mVrms typical, 6Vrms maximum (RCA connectors)
300mVrms typical, 12Vrms maximum (XLR connectors, MC-12HD
Balanced only) Maximum value with full-scale input signal and
volume at +12dB
Output Impedance 100" in parallel with 150pF (RCA outputs); 50" in parallel with
150pF (XLR outputs, MC-12 Balanced only)
Performance (Zone 2 and Record Zone)
Analog-to-Digital 24-bit, 44.1 to 96kHz, dual-bit S!
Conversion architecture (Record Zone only)
Digital-to-Analog 24-bit, 44.1 to 192kHz, multi-bit S! architecture
Conversion
Frequency Response
10Hz to 20kHz, +0.1dB/-0.25dB,-0.75dB at 40kHz, reference 1kHz
THD + Noise Below 0.005% at 1kHz, maximum output level
Dynamic Range 105dB minimum, 108dB typical, 22kHz bandwidth
Signal-to-Noise Ratio 105dB minimum, 108dB typical, 22kHz bandwidth
Input Sensitivity 200mVrms (4Vrms for maximum output level)
Input Impedance 100k" in parallel with 150pF
Output Level 200mVrms typical, 4Vrms maximum (RCA connectors)
400mVrms typical, 8Vrms maximum (XLR connectors, Zone 2
only, MC-12HD Balanced only) Maximum value with full-scale
input signal and volume at 0dB
Output Impedance 100" in parallel with 150pF (RCA outputs); 50" in
parallel with 150pF (XLR outputs, Zone 2 only, MC-12 HD
Balanced only)
Video Inputs and Outputs
Video Inputs Two composite (RCA), three S-video, and
four component video (three RCA, one BNC)
Video Outputs Four composite (RCA, two monitor and two record),
four S-video (two monitor and two record), and one
component (BNC)

Logic 7 technology is a proprietary suite of surround algorithms developed by Lexicon. Unlike other surround decoders,
Logic 7 is compatible with all input sources and requires no special encoding for playback. Applied to music recordings, it increases
the sense of spaciousness in the listening area without altering the front soundstage, resulting in a more realistic recreation of the
original recording. Applied to film soundtracks, it expands stereo sources to 7.1 channels for performance that rivals that of discrete
multi-channel sources. Playback of discrete multi-channel recordings also benefits from Logic 7 as it derives two additional channels
from 5.1-channel sources to create more envelopment at the listening position. Logic 7 employs proprietary techniques to provide
a superior sense of spaciousness without sacrificing detail. Music or film, stereo or discrete multi-channel – Logic 7 delivers an
unrivaled listening experience.
